A Tiered Loyalty Ladder That Fuels Exponential Growth
YesStyle's influencer program is a masterclass in gamification, structured around three escalating tiers: Rising Star, Star, and Superstar: that transform casual promoters into dedicated advocates. Entry is low-friction: just 500 followers for 10% commissions on new customer savings, with payouts as low as $20. But progression unlocks a cascade of rewards: Star tier at $300 in referrals brings free monthly products and referral bonuses for recruiting others; Superstar at $5,000 adds 11% commissions, VIP bundles worth $200-300, personal managers, and end-of-year gifts. This pyramid incentivizes upward mobility, where top creators subsidize the base by bringing in new recruits, creating a self-perpetuating flywheel. Psychologically, it taps into loss aversion: creators chase tiers to avoid stagnation: and reciprocity, as freebies and perks deepen commitment.
Bio Links as Passive Revenue Machines
The genius lies in simplicity: creators pin YesStyle links at the top of their bios, turning profiles into evergreen sales funnels. With exclusive discount codes (up to 15% off) and early launch access, these links generate passive traffic from bio-stalkers and loyal followers. Unlike ephemeral stories or posts, bios persist, accumulating clicks over time. This strategy exploits platform behaviors: Instagram users routinely check bios for shoppable links: while the commission model rewards creators directly for the savings they enable (e.g., $10 saved equals $10 earned). It's a win-win: brands get qualified traffic, creators get effortless income.
Why Micro-UGC Trumps Macro-Influencers
Forget the myth of needing mega-influencers for scale. YesStyle's army of UGC accounts: often niche beauty pages promoting multiple brands: delivers authenticity at volume. Videos rarely explode, but their ubiquity creates 'ambient awareness': everywhere you scroll, YesStyle appears. This mirrors ambient advertising in physical retail, where repetition breeds familiarity and trust. Smaller creators boast higher engagement rates (nano-influencers convert 8x better than stars, per industry benchmarks), and their content feels genuine, dodging ad fatigue. The program's influencer-only focus and monthly caps prevent dilution, ensuring steady output without burnout.
Outmaneuvering Competitors in a Crowded Arena
Compared to rivals like Shein or Stylenvy, YesStyle's edges are sharp: higher commissions (up to 11% vs. 6-8%), longer cookie windows (30 days), free products from early tiers, and a recruiter bonus system absent elsewhere. Amazon Associates lags with tiny 0.5-5% rates and no perks. This combination yields superior creator retention and acquisition, turning competitors' flat models into YesStyle's moat. In K-beauty, where quality meets affordability and free global shipping, these incentives amplify word-of-mouth, making the brand a staple for US and European shoppers seeking value.
Replicating the YesStyle Playbook for Your Brand
To build your version: Start with accessible entry (low follower thresholds, quick payouts). Layer in tiers with tangible unlocks like products and bonuses. Seed the network via free samples to your existing audience. Track bios religiously: offer tools for easy link pinning. Cap incentives to maintain quality. Measure success not by views, but by referral revenue and creator net growth. Test on Instagram first, expand to TikTok/Pinterest. With disciplined execution, even modest e-com brands can cultivate thousands of advocates driving sustainable revenue.
